About Aron H. Lichtman

Aron H. Lichtman is a scholar working on Pharmacology, Toxicology and Cellular and Molecular Neuroscience, having authored 240 papers that have together received 15.4k indexed citations. Recurring topics across this work include Cannabis and Cannabinoid Research (191 papers), Neurotransmitter Receptor Influence on Behavior (85 papers) and Neuroscience and Neuropharmacology Research (68 papers). The work is most often cited by research in Pharmacology (12.3k citations), Toxicology (1.9k citations) and Cellular and Molecular Neuroscience (7.2k citations). Aron H. Lichtman has collaborated with scholars based in United States, Canada and Italy. Frequent co-authors include Benjamin F. Cravatt, Billy R. Martin, Steven G. Kinsey, Stephen A. Varvel, Jonathan Z. Long, Laura E. Wise, Joel E. Schlosburg, Michael H. Bracey, Rehab A. Abdullah and Lamont Booker. Their work appears in journals such as Science, Proceedings of the National Academy of Sciences and Journal of the American Chemical Society.
